Packing Light
When you go backpacking, you will also find out about your survival skills. The object of backpacking is to survive with as many or as few things as possible.
If you have strong survival skills, you will be feeling more comfortable than usual. You should know how much water you can carry and how to set up a camp without your back becoming too heavy.
Being able to cook without having to carry a lot of unnecessary utensils will lighten your pack as well. In short, the less you must pack, the better off you are.
